About The Cherry Orchard
The Cherry Orchard is a 3D kinetic novel adaptation of the classic play by Anton Chekhov. An eccentric aristocrat and her friends try to sort out her debts so that she isn’t forced to sell her beloved cherry orchard, but there’s just one problem: she doesn’t understand the value of money at all.
